COLLECTOR

Job Description: Responsible for processing and collection activity on all past due patient account balances.

Qualifications – High School Diploma/GED required. Experience required in one or more of the following areas: patient care, public relations, customer service or other related area. Previous knowledge of dealing with different types of insurances in a medical setting is preferred.

Work Schedule: M – F, 8 a.m. – 5 p.m.
